City of Beloit to operate seven polling locations in August primary election

BELOIT, Wis. -- The City of Beloit will operate seven polling operations for the August primary election.
The election starts on Tuesday August 13 and the city said it no longer administers elections in elementary schools and introduced new polling sites in 2024.
Residents can visit the polling website to find their polling location .
The official polling locations are:
Ward 1-4 24-25, 31- Sun Valley Presbyterian Church, 1650 Sun Valley Dr.
Ward: 5-8,26 Our Savior's Lutheran Church, 749 Bluff St
Ward: 9-11 Krueger-Haskell Golf Course, 1611 Hackett St.
Ward: 12 First Congregational Church 801 Bushnell St.
Ward 13-17 Beloit Public Library 605 Eclipse Blvd
Ward: 18-20, 27 River of Life United Methodist Church, 2345 Prairie Ave.
Ward: 21-23, 28-30 Central Christian Church, 2460 Milwaukee Rd
The seven polling locations in Beloit are open from 7 am to 8pm. All polling places are accessible to elderly and disabled voters.
Important deadlines and absentee voting information
July 16, 2024 was the last day for voters to establish residency in Beloit. Voters who establish residency after this date must vote in the municipality they resided in previously.
Deadline to file voter registration paperwork by mail or online: Wednesday July 24
Deadline to file voter registration paperwork at City Hall: 5pm Friday August 9; you can still register at your polling location on Election Day
Deadline to request an absentee ballot to be sent through the mail: 5 pm Thursday August 8 (5 pm Friday August 9, if voter is indefinitely confided or military and not away from home.
Do not place ballots in City Hall drop boxes ; either return via the U.S. Postal Service or return directly to the 2nd floor clerk-treasurer's office. Please allow enough time for absentee ballots to return via mail as they must by in the clerk-treasurer's office by 8 pm Election Day.
Only the voter can return the ballot to the clerk's office or place in the mail unless a voter with disabilities needs help returning their ballots.
Make sure all fields are properly filled out, including the witness signature and address.
In-person absentee voting days and hours: 8:30 a.m.-4 pm weekdays July 30-August 9, 2024 (open to 5pm Friday, August 9). In-person absentee voting will take place on the 2nd floor at City Hall.
Deadline for absentee ballots to be in the clerk's office: 8 pm Tuesday, August 13.
Voters with any additional questions are asked to contact the City of Beloit's City Clerk's office at (608)364-6680.
